Mathematics and Theoretical Foundations Harvard places significant emphasis on the mathematical underpinnings of computer science. Advanced Electives and Specializations As students progress, the requirements shift toward allowing deep exploration of specific interests.
Exploring Harvard CS Elective Flexibility and Degree Requirements
Capstone Projects and Research Upper-level requirements frequently include a capstone project or independent research component. The curriculum emphasizes both theoretical understanding and practical application, ensuring graduates are prepared for diverse careers in technology, research, and innovation.
Collaboration with faculty members is often encouraged, providing valuable mentorship and real-world application of classroom concepts. Advanced electives cover areas such as artificial intelligence, systems programming, human-computer interaction, and data science.
Exploring Harvard CS Elective Flexibility and Specialization Options
Departmental Resources and Support Harvard supports its computer science students through robust resources, including tutoring centers, coding workshops, and dedicated advising. This focus ensures students can engage with complex theoretical concepts, analyze algorithmic efficiency, and contribute to cutting-edge research areas like machine learning and cryptography.
More About Harvard computer science requirements
Looking at Harvard computer science requirements from another angle can help expand the discussion and give readers a second clear paragraph under the same section.
More perspective on Harvard computer science requirements can make the topic easier to follow by connecting earlier points with a few simple takeaways.